How can I find a dermatologist in Brownstown, Washington, and what should I look for?
You can find dermatologists in Brownstown by searching local healthcare directories, checking with your primary care provider for referrals, or using your insurance company's provider search tool. Look for board-certified dermatologists with good patient reviews and convenient office locations, such as those near the Brownstown Medical Center or along major routes like State Route 14.

What insurance plans are commonly accepted by dermatologists in Brownstown, and what are my payment options?
Most dermatology practices in Brownstown accept major insurance plans like Premera Blue Cross, Regence BlueShield, and Medicare, but it's crucial to verify with the specific clinic before your appointment. For those without insurance or with high deductibles, many offices offer self-pay discounts, payment plans, or accept major credit cards and HSA/FSA accounts to help manage costs.
What is the typical wait time for a new patient dermatology appointment in Brownstown, and how can I schedule one?
For non-urgent concerns, new patient wait times in Brownstown can range from 2 to 8 weeks, though some clinics may have cancellation lists for earlier slots. You can schedule an appointment by calling a clinic directly, such as those affiliated with the local medical groups, or increasingly through online patient portals that allow you to book, reschedule, and complete intake forms digitally.
